Testing an AVR controlled triac based dimmer circuit. This test used lower voltages and isolated power supplies but the real thing will be partially mains connected. Control parts are optoisolated for safety.

So I was feeling a bit bored, and at the same time, I wanted to test out my freshly made "Solar Lantern".
Anyways I saw some online instruct-ables on how to build a cool solar light. So I went to ikea and bought a mason jar, and borrowed the electronic parts, and put em all together.....and voila! A solar lantern.
Anyways, for the real test. I wanted to see what the difference between using a skylight filter on the amount of light it actually blocks. When I first bought my camera a while back ago, I was naive and didn't know better. The Black's employee convinced me that I needed a skylight filter to protect all my fancy lens from getting scratched. So I bought 2 OPTEX SKYLIGHT FILTERS (52mm). They were $14.99. Then I recently read an article online that cheapo filters (this one), actually blocks out a lot of light.... but how much worse?
So, shown here are 2 different photos. One WITH the filter (top), and one WITHOUT the filter (bottom).
Can you see a difference in the amount of good light that gets filtered out? These are identical exposure values for both shot, and haven't been edited in any way. Also note the reduction in sharpness.... I'm sure as hell not using these craptacular filters anymore.

Over the weekend of 14th -15th September 2024, a two car Xplorer consisting of cars 2502/2522 was used on a number of what seems to be some particular test/trial runs, which included several runs from the Meeks Road Goods Junction to Hurstville and return.
Seeing an Xplorer on the Illawarra line is quite a rare sight, as seen here with the cars passing through on the Up through Carlton.
